ASN Aircraft accident Antonov An-2PF SP-TBB Trebinje
ASN logo
 

Status:
Date:Monday 5 February 1979
Type:Silhouette image of generic AN2 model; specific model in this crash may look slightly different
Antonov An-2PF
Operator:Aeropol
Registration: SP-TBB
MSN: 1G159-02
First flight:
Crew:Fatalities: / Occupants:
Passengers:Fatalities: / Occupants:
Total:Fatalities: 3 / Occupants: 3
Aircraft damage: Damaged beyond repair
Location:Trebinje (   Bosnia and Herzegovina)
Phase: Unknown (UNK)
Nature:Ferry/positioning
Departure airport:?
Destination airport:?
Narrative:
Flew into the side of Bjelasnica Mountain at an elevation of about 1370 m.
